IMG_2786 RED JJBI have worked as a professional photographer for 17 yrs and qualified as a Licentiate with the British Institute of Professional Photography.

My images have been displayed in Bonhams, the Royal West of England Academy and I have had a solo exhibition in Trinity College, Oxford.

I specialise in informal portraiture  carried out in your own home, garden or place of your choice. Much of my work is photographing families, often including three generations – plus the animals!  I also do individual portrait sessions and special sessions with special animals.

After years using studio lighting and film I find the  freedom and spontanaity that results from working with people in their own homes using a good digital camera is far better.   The result is relaxed studies which not only capture the sitter’s character and style, but also the atmosphere that goes with a unique sense of place.
